What exactly is K Rend?
K Rend is a pre-mixed silicone render designed to give exterior walls a durable, breathable and water-repellent finish. It's available in a wide range of colours and needs less maintenance than traditional sand and cement render.

Is K Rend better than sand and cement?
While traditional sand and cement render is technically cheaper, K Rend is often the preferred choice. That’s because K Rend offers:
- Better breathability
- Colour-through pigmentation (meaning no painting needed)
- Has better resistance to cracking
Meanwhile, standard sand and cement render usually need painting and more ongoing maintenance. So, the costs can stack up over time.
What are the disadvantages of K Rend?
While K Rend has many benefits, there are a few cons to point out:
- It can cost more per m² compared to standard render
- Dodgy installation can lead to cracking or uneven curing
- Surfaces may need additional preparation, such as mesh, depending on the wall type
Choosing an installer with plenty of experience applying K Rend will make sure you get a quality, durable job.
Can you K Rend over existing render?
Yes, the bonus of K Rend is that it can be applied over existing render. But only if the surface is stable, well-bonded and not failing. Installers may need to:
- Remove loose areas
- Apply a base coat
- Add reinforcement mesh
An experienced installer will assess whether the existing surface is suitable on their site visit.
How long does K Rend last?
When applied professionally, K Rend typically lasts 20–30 years. Its silicone technology helps it resist weathering, cracking, and algae build-up, making it one of the most durable render options.
